Concrete Void Filling in Hillside, NJ

Property owners in Hillside, NJ who notice subsurface void formation are looking at the surface of a problem that started below it. Subsurface voids form when water migrates through or beneath a slab and carries fine soil particles with it, leaving hollow chambers that offer no support to the concrete above. The clay-heavy Watchung soil with pronounced freeze-thaw impact on older concrete that characterizes much of Union County, NJ creates the sub-base instability that eventually becomes visible at the concrete surface.

Scaldino Basement Solutions evaluates the sub-base condition at each Hillside, NJ property before recommending a correction. Void filling involves drilling small-diameter ports through the slab, mapping the cavity extent with a probe, and pumping high-density polyurethane foam that expands to fill the void and bonds to the underside of the concrete. The result holds through the same seasonal cycle that created the original failure.

Every Hillside, NJ project at Scaldino Basement Solutions produces a written record: what was found during the evaluation, what method was selected, and why. Void formation beneath slabs results from water infiltration through cracks and joints that erodes fine soil particles over time, leaving unsupported chambers beneath the concrete. That diagnosis drives the process: drilling 5/8-inch ports at grid intervals, probing void depth and lateral extent, injecting two-component polyurethane in controlled lifts, confirming solid fill by percussion test, and patching ports with hydraulic cement.
